Chapter Eleven
"Peter, what are you looking at?" Alex said, as he followed Peter's gaze to the bushes. Suddenly, on the other side, Ezra and Althea stood up, aware they were found. They took off running.
"Somebody! Stop them! But leave that damn angel to me!" Alex yelled. "Melissa, stay here. We need to start the ritual, but we can't do that without catching those two. If you're right, the only way we can get through to Althea would be through her Guardian Angel."
Peter overheard the entire thing, and watched as Jennifer, Adam, and Alex took off after Ezra and Althea. Despite Peter's anger and hatred toward the young angel, Ezra was still his friend. He never remembered why he left Ezra or even told him off, but maybe there was a way to make things up. However, he had to make sure he still played by the rules.
Peter took off after his group of friends, hoping to head them off at the pass. He cut through the vegetation without even thinking about plants pricking him or trapping him in a vast number of vines. All he cared about was trying to get Ezra and Althea as far away as he could. But as he neared the exit, Peter stopped and saw that Althea and Ezra had separated. With the two separated, that left both vulnerable. Peter stopped and debated who to follow before deciding to follow Ezra. He paused and hid behind the tree as Ezra came face to face with Alex.
*~*~*
Ezra and Althea separated, which was probably the worst thing they could have done. Ezra's job was to protect Althea, and this time, he was determined not to lose another charge. The first charge was Peter, and that had failed. No matter what he tried to do, whether it was warning Peter not to go down the dark road, or just trying to act like a brother to him, nothing seemed to work. Ezra wasn't about to go down without a fight. Now here he was, standing in front of Alex, waiting for him to make the first move.
"You know you're becoming a pain in the ass, Ezra," Alex said. "No matter what we do, you're always there. Why don't you get it? Peter is no longer your charge. He's a member of our coven."
"Peter was a great kid before you fill his head with darkness," Ezra said, narrowing his eyes at his enemy.
"Fill his head with darkness?" Alex laughed. "No, Ezra, he was already filled with it. You couldn't handle the fact that there is something more to him than you thought."
Angered, Ezra summoned his blade. It was the last time that the Servants of Evil were going to get in his hair. He would let nothing happen to Althea, not while he had the chance to protect her.
"Really?" Alex said. "This is your big move. A fight? Sorry Ezra, but I think we've got the upper hand."
At first, Ezra didn't quite understand what Alex was talking about, that is until he looked over and noticed Jennifer. With a snap of her fingers all Ezra could feel was someone grabbing him from behind. On his left side, Adam had him by the arm. He tried to vanish but to his dismay he couldn't. Adam must have performed a spell because now Ezra couldn't even disappear or fight back. Adam quickly disarmed him and wrapped his arm around Ezra's neck. Ezra struggled to breathe and break free. This had never happened in all his life of being a Guardian Angel. Now he felt so much more human than before. Ezra's vision blurred as he saw the outline of Alex and Jennifer.
"Nice talking to you, Ezra, but right now we need you to help lure your little charge to us."
With that, Ezra's vision went dark.
*~*~*
Althea stopped at a nearby rock, out of breath and worried, thinking that Ezra would catch up with her. But to no avail. She didn't know where he went or what had happened after they separated. Panicked, she stood and called out to him, despite knowing that it was a terrible idea to let her pursuers know where she was. Rather than Ezra coming from the main campus, Peter exited instead, looking flabbergasted.
"What the hell?" Althea said as she hid from view behind a large tree and grabbed a heavy branch. She waited until Peter got close and swung it, attempting to hit him in the head. However, Peter caught it before Althea could land a blow.
"Whoa!" Peter exclaimed. "Althea! Chill! I'm not going to do anything to you!"
"The hell you won't!" Althea exclaimed and pulled the branch from his grasp. She tried to attack him again. "Where is he?!" Peter grabbed the branch from Althea's hands and snapped it in two. "Calm yourself down first."
Althea glared daggers at Peter, until eventually the anger in her eyes faded. "Look what you're thinking, but if you come with me right now, we can save Ezra."
"And how would you propose we do that? Are you telling me you idiots captured Ezra?"
"This wasn't part of the plan," Peter responded. "We would not do any harm to him. We simply needed you to help us."
"Because you need the blood of a Nephilim to summon whatever it is," Althea said.
"You can cuss all you want, but if you don't come with me, then there's no way we could save Ezra."
"You want me to trust you, after all that you've put us through?"
"Hey! You're the one who was hiding behind that bush. I know you were at the campsite yesterday."
"Campsite? It's a cabin!"
"Tomato tamato." Peter rolled his eyes. "My guess is they probably brought Ezra back to the cabin, where they'll use him as bait to track you."
"If they wanted me, why didn't they just capture me?"
"Because Ezra would prevent that from happening," he explained. "And for your information, Althea, I know who he is. I know you're confused, and I know he hasn't told you the full story yet, but before he was your angel, he was mine."
"That's impossible."
"Nothing is impossible. Now unless you want to stand out here and talk, we should get back to that cabin. Don't give me that look," Peter continued. "I'm not luring you into a trap. I saw everything that happened and from the way it sounds, this Melissa girl is the one who gave my friends the idea to capture Ezra. What are we waiting for? Let's go!" The two raced into the forest and to the cabin.
